ArmInfo. Turkey is not appeasing, continuing to express support to Azerbaijan at different levels in connection with the escalation on the Armenian-Azerbaijani state border.
This time, four factions of the Grand National Assembly (Parliament) of Turkey issued a joint statement in which they strongly "condemned the provocations and attacks of the Armenian Armed Forces."
The document was signed by representatives of the ruling Justice and Development Party (AK Party), the Republican People's Party (CHP), the National Movement Party (MHP) and the Good Party (IYI Party). "Armenia is on the wrong path. These events represent the biggest obstacle on the way to sustainable peace and stability in the South Caucasus," the statement says.
The parliament called the international community to properly respond to the "illegal actions of Armenia." "We reaffirm our support for the peaceful settlement of the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ict within the internationally recognized borders and territorial integrity of Azerbaijan. Relying on the principle of" two states, one nation "Turkey will support Azerbaijan's efforts to restore its territorial integrity with all its capabilities," the declaration emphasizes.
Earlier, with a statement of support for Azerbaijan, military and political leadership of Turkey. Yerevan has already strongly condemned such behavior of Turkey, which is a member of the OSCE Minsk Group.
